Irregular Period, Breast Feeding. Had Cysts On Ovary Removed, One Ruptured. Suggested Endometrial Biopsy. Explain

I had two cysts on my left ovary removed on Sept.9, 2013. One was ruptured and the other was 10 cm. Also, my menstrual cycle did not resume after breast feeding my daughter for 21months. The Dr. discussed doing an endometrial biopsy or D&C. He wants to do a biopsy. I prefer a D&C so I will be sleep and unable to feel the pain. He wants to test the lining of my uterus and says he will get more info from the biopsy. What's the difference between the two procedures? Is the biopsy painful? Which procedure should I get?

A D and C also provides information regarding the uterine lining.
IT is comparable to a biopsy.
You can definitely go for the biopsy, as it is done within seconds, it is not painful, and can be done easily in the OPD.
The difference is that D and C is done under anaesthesia, and all the walls of the uterus are scraped, the mouth of the uterus is dilated and then curettage is done.
In taking an endometrial biopsy, no anesthesia or dilatation is required.
